CABARRUS COUNTY <br />BOARD OF COMMISSIONERS <br />REGULAR MEETING <br />AGENDA CATEGORY: <br />Consent Agenda <br />JUNE 18, 2018 <br />6:30 P.M. <br />SUBJECT: <br />Finance - Kannapolis City School Paving Request <br />BRIEF SUMMARY: <br />The FY19 Capital Improvement Projects include a $1,000,000 request <br />from Kannapolis City Schools for paving at A L Brown High School. The <br />Capital Reserve Fund has $1,005,086 in unused contingency from the <br />completed Mt. Pleasant Middle School Project. Management has <br />discussed the possibility of using $500,000 of this balance to help fund 1/2 <br />of the paving request at A L Brown High School and the remaining <br />$505,086 for a future Cabarrus County School project need. <br />REQUESTED ACTION: <br />Motion to approve the use of $500,000 in Capital Reserve Funds for 1/2 of <br />the paving request at A L Brown High School and to approve the <br />associated Budget Amendment and Project Ordinances. <br />EXPECTED LENGTH OF PRESENTATION: <br />5 Minutes <br />SUBMITTED BY: <br />Susan Fearrington, Finance Director <br />BUDGET AMENDMENT REQUIRED: <br />Yes <br />COUNTY MANAGER'S RECOMMENDATIONS/COMMENTS: <br />F-9 Page 385 <br />
